How does the 12-inch frost depth affect fence post footings in Ames Lake?
Frost heave from the 12-inch frost line will lift and crack inadequately set posts. The IRC requires footings for structural posts to extend below the frost line. Posts in the Ames Lake Plateau neighborhood that are set in shallow concrete will fail within two winters due to this uplift force.

Do modern gate systems meet pool safety and liability standards?
Yes. Integrated IoT keypad or Wi-Fi gate latches can be configured to self-close and self-latch automatically. This meets the active 2026 requirements of the IBC/IRC Appendix AG and King County Code, which mandate such features to limit homeowner liability around pools.
What are the legal requirements for replacing a shared fence with my neighbor?
Washington’s Good Neighbor Fence Law (RCW 16.60.020) requires written notice to the adjoining owner before replacing a shared boundary fence. In Ames Lake, this 2026 legal step is mandatory to establish shared cost liability and avoid a partition fence dispute.
Is a standard fence design sufficient for the 105 MPH V-ult wind rating?
No. A 105 MPH V-ult wind speed requires engineered resistance. Post spacing must be reduced, concrete footings enlarged, and all brackets must be rated for high-wind uplift per ASCE 7-22 standards to survive peak storm season gusts off the Plateau.
What are the fence height and placement rules for my property?
Ames Lake zoning enforces a 4-foot front yard and 6-foot rear yard height limit, with a 0-foot setback allowing construction on the property line. On a corner lot, a sight triangle for driver visibility must be maintained, especially near high-traffic corridors like SR-202, where no visual obstruction is permitted.
What is required before digging fence post holes?
You must contact Washington 811 for a full utility locate at least two business days before excavation. Hitting a power or gas line in Ames Lake Plateau is a major financial and safety liability. A professional manages this ticket and all associated King County permit office paperwork.
How do soil conditions and pests influence material choice?
The low-to-moderate soil corrosivity and slight-to-moderate termite risk dictate compatible materials. Pressure-treated Southern Yellow Pine or cedar resist decay, but all fasteners must be hot-dip galvanized or stainless steel to prevent rust streaks from forming on the wood.
